Transaction 3bb7e6f94cf172bbccab880396e98e944c052cf70b6e1c58b9051626ce44fdd8
1 Input
1 Output
-
3bb7e6f94cf172bbccab880396e98e944c052cf70b6e1c58b9051626ce44fdd8:0
- value
- 16535629
- script pubkey
- OP_0 OP_PUSHBYTES_20 69a99355d0cb9ce50127e51489f889bfc83a3843
- address
- bc1qdx5ex4wsewww2qf8u52gn7yfhlyr5wzrzzv9fq